Gojira vs. Mekagojira (2) Release Date: December 10, 1993 (Japan) Director: Takao Okawara Special Effects Director: Koichi Kawakita Producer: Shogo Tomiyama Distributor: Toho Co., Ltd. godzilla vs. mechagodzilla ii internet archive

The film establishes Baby Godzilla (later Godzilla Junior), who becomes a major character in subsequent Heisei films.
